Цивилизационное развитие общества очень быстро меняется. Всё то, что еще вчера было сказкой, теперь превратилось в действительность. Изображенные некогда в научной фантастике технологии уверенно вошли в наши будни. Здесь и биотехнологии, и сотовая связь и «интеллектуальные» гаджеты и прорывные открытия в различных отраслях промышленности. Или например моментальный контакт в чатах и коммуникация между людьми, как в соседних комнатах, так и на другом конце Земли. Освоение новых интеллектуальных технологий дает возможность во много раз форсировать цивилизационный рост и показывает головокружительные идеи будущего. С прибавлением скорости развития супертехнологий повышается и величина информации, которую надо планомерно читать и подвергать анализу. И все делают люди. И дабы успешно выполнять глобальные идеи, стоит вооружиться новейшими познаниями в таких сферах как программирование, анализ данных, машинное обучение и робототехника.
Программирование — одно из самых увлекательных и быстрорастущих профессиональных направлений. К тому же, это развивающая интеллект деятельность. На самом деле IT-специалист способен на многие «чудеса» — например, сделать компьютерный «мозг», обеспечив электронику программными командами. Очевидно, что без автоматизированных систем и программирования не может обойтись ни одна компания и ни одно производство.
Программирование — захватывающий и обучающий вид деятельности. Обучение программированию с нуля необходимо стремиться освоить даже с первого класса. Обеспечение пользы здесь — корректно подготовленная теоретическая основа. Всевозможные игры для обучения программированию с особым вниманием на практику предоставляют ученикам удачную перспективу испытать себя на этом пути. Преобладающей идеей является развитие интеллекта и логики у учащегося. Когда же стоит знакомить детей с подобного рода факультативом? Самым лучшим считается возраст 9-14 лет. И все же, существуют методологии развития дошкольников еще c 3-х лет. Естественно, ребёнок не сможет создать код как и разобраться в основах программирования. А всевозможные конструкторы, живые плакаты и ребусы очень помогут. Первое время специалисты советуют привлекать легкие «развивашки». Например, конструктор Кликко, дающий превращать плоские квадраты и треугольники в пространственные и проектировать занимательные игрушки — лодку или динозавра. Деятельность подобного рода развивает математический склад ума и координацию движения. Когда дошкольник станет учеником, можно записать его в группу программирования для начинающих.
В нашей стране, как и во всем мире, организовывается большое количество состязаний по робототехнике. Одним из лучших явлений данной тематики является Кубок Знатока. В контексте которого проходят соревнования по программированию Знаток программирования. Принимают участие содружества, представляющие школы, ассоциации робототехники а также, товарищеские общества и простые любители. Эти события без сомнения положительный эксперимент как для педагогов, так и для школьников.
Для результативного освоения начального уровня языков программирования и робототехники школьникам смогут посодействовать электронные конструкторы. Чемпионом по распространенности последнее время приходятся разработанные на «Arduino». Проект начал получать признание вследствие своей простоты и дружелюбности. Совсем не имеющий никакого понятия о программировании и схемотехнике покупатель без проблем поймет как работать с Arduino в общем за один день. Конструкторы Для Arduino включают в себя чипы, осуществляющие руководство всеми без исключения машинами и электронными системами. К электронной плате «Arduino» можно подключать всевозможные экраны и лампочки, и множество других компонентов. Контроль над ними реализовывается при содействии программируемой среды. Для квалифицированной работы пригодятся знания. В частности C++. Начинающим даны в помощь множественные событийно-ориентированные среды с последовательностью блоков. В частности, scratch — графический язык программирования для начинающих, заслуживший очень широкое использование в мире. Работая с ним легко усвоить, что собой представляют алгоритмы и условия. Python нельзя назвать ведущим ресурсом для программирования микроконтроллеров, но он нужен для работы с приборами. Познавание идей робототехники с Ардуино будет стоить упорства и трудолюбия. Тем не менее, на выходе будет фантастическое переживание от собранных самостоятельно умных устройств.
Грядущие перспективы — за роботизированными системами и искусственным интеллектом. Но без участия экспертов, работающих над новыми изобретениями, оно неосуществимо. Именно поэтому овладение языками программирования оказывается главнейшим аспектом образовательного процесса в наши дни. От того, насколько достойным и перспективным для молодых будет получение знаний, зависит и техническое развитие общества.